Storage And Shelf Life Insights
Proper storage is essential for preserving flavor, texture, and nutritional quality. Temperature, humidity, and light exposure all influence how long each bucket remains at peak condition.
Dry goods often last years, while chilled items require careful monitoring. Labeling each container with purchase and rotation dates helps you use products before quality declines.
Emergency Preparedness Applications
Many households rely on food buckets as a core element of emergency readiness. These kits can cover several days of nutrition with minimal preparation during power outages or severe weather.
Choose buckets with long shelf life and broad nutritional coverage to maintain energy and morale during unexpected events. Rotate stock at least once a year to preserve safety and freshness.
